Output 676e91bfcc4e06ae7466b82ffb60fa217a1135ed57718c2425ea03a5ca3230ba:0

value
998518
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5791d04cbc8fb662efd5d5ad9d6327b5000c90da OP_EQUAL
address
MFtBhRwozocw6ZjMS1G9mmGPuMyjrycLjH
transaction
676e91bfcc4e06ae7466b82ffb60fa217a1135ed57718c2425ea03a5ca3230ba
spent
true